    Job Description

    This is an office-based position in Toronto, ON, Canada. This position has a hybrid schedule that includes office-based and home-based days.

    • Provides startup support for selected projects to Study Startup Managers starting from handover to Operations until all sites are activated
    • Participates in regional kick-off meetings/calls between local project team, Project Manager and/or designees and local representatives of Feasibility, Regulatory and Legal departments
    • May participate in the organization of the sponsor kick off meetings and Investigator Meetings
    • Provides support and technical assistance in feasibility and site identification process.
    • Coordinates and/or performs all administrative activities including: documents collection/distribution, translation, filing, CTMS maintenance, minutes keeping, OSF preparation, trackers maintenance, etc.
    • Under supervision, coordinates ordering, tracking and distribution of initial study medication and clinical supplies to the sites (as applicable)
    • Coordinates and supports preparation of initial submission dossiers to competent authorities, ethics committees, and/or site submission dossiers (as applicable)
    • Coordinates and supports contract negotiation process and provides adequate tracking and follow-up
    • Coordinates and supports preparation of IP-RED packages
    • Performs training of team members tailored to the project needs, when required
    • Monitors startup key performance indicators for a selected group of projects on a regional/country level
    • Identifies and escalates operational issues
    • Cooperates with other startup functions (Study Startup Manager Country/Region, Site Contract Coordinator Country/Region etc.), where applicable, in conducting trainings related to project and site startup
    • Takes part in the developing and updating local instructions and guidelines related to startup activities
    • May assist the Study Startup Manager Country/Region or designee with creating regional benchmarks for startup key performance indicators
    Qualifications
    • College or University degree or an equivalent combination of education and experience that provides the individual with the required knowledge, skills, and abilities
    • Minimum 18 months industry experience in clinical research in an administrative role
    • Excellent knowledge of FDA guidelines and ICH GCP
    • Experience in study startup is preferred
